Does a 1999 nissan altima gxe have a timing belt or a timing chain and if it does have a chain does it have to be replaced as often as a belt?

I think it has a chain. look where the timing chain/ belt should be. if there is a large plastic cover, it has a belt, it its a aluminum cover, it has a chain. there is no replacement interval on a chain.

Timing belt replacement millage

The Nissan Altima does not use a timing belt, it uses a chain driven camshaft, timing chains have no set mileage and should last the life of the engine.
